How do you make DIY soap at home?

Transcript

To make DIY soap at home, you can use either the melt-and-pour method or the cold process. For melt-and-pour, melt a pre-made soap base, add fragrances or colorants, pour into molds, and let it harden. For cold process, mix lye with water (always add lye to water), then combine with oils, blend until trace, pour into molds, and cure for 4 to 6 weeks. Always wear protective gear when working with lye.
